Gyllenhaal (noble family)
Gyllenhaal is a Swedish noble family from the district of Älvsborgs län (now Västra Götalands län ). The name comes from a peasant tenant (Swedish: "Kronobonde") named Gunne Olsson from the small hamlet of Härene . He was also called Gunne Haal . His son, the cavalry lieutenant Nils Haal (died 1680/1681), was ennobled in 1652 under the name Gyllenhaal. In 1672 the family was registered at the Swedish knight house . In 1866 the grandson of the researcher Leonard Gyllenhaal , Anders Leonard Gyllenhaal, emigrated to the USA and started a family there. The motive for his emigration should not, as with many of his compatriots, have been based on poverty and hunger. Some of Anders Gyllenhaal's descendants became known in American films .
